Dear You~Create a Plan of Action

Nessa Grace-My Plan of Action

 

Dear You,

It’s been a while since I’ve written anything at all. However, not without a good reason. My vision for this blog is to help motivate and encourage others and try to do so without incorporating too much of my personal life. However; as writers we all know it’s hard to have a blog and not include something personal or provide a personal insight on any given topic.

Writing full-time is my ultimate career goal. However, for me personally I know there are steps I need to take to get to this point. One of which was to make a major career change that would cut the time back I would have to physically work, sustain my current income and provide me an opportunity to help others. I remember sitting in church in August of 2013, asking God to lead me in the direction where I could financially stay at home for six months and write. I also remember verbally stating this to my friend who was with me that day and laughing about it as if I was wishing to win the lottery or something. Then a week and a half later I was laid off from my job of 5 1/2 years.

It was a corporate layoff where 74 other people were laid off just like me. We were taken to the Human Resource department and split up into different meeting rooms depending on your job title. I was grouped with people who were in supervisory roles and I think I was the only person ecstatic about the whole situation. How could I not be? They offered a severance pay for my five plus years of service and I can apply for unemployment without the company opposing it. I was in a writer’s financial heaven as far as I was concerned. However, my goal for writing the entire time I was taking off from working took a drastic turn and I ended up doing something completely different.

The end of the third week after my layoff, I was online bored on a Friday night. For some reason massage therapy came into my mind and I began looking into schools and getting more information. Massage therapy was something I had always been interested in, but being a mom of three kids and in a single income household I never thought I would have the opportunity to go back to school. So here was my chance. I first looked at the median income for my area and it surpassed the income I was making in the corporate world. I found the closest school to my home and filled out the request for more information. The next day the recruiter called me and set up an appointment for Monday to tour the school. I went and took the tour and before I left, I was signed up and ready to start orientation that Thursday and class the following Monday. Impulsive decision I know!

You’re off to great places. Today is your day. Your mountain is waiting, so get on your way. ~Dr. Seuss

When I told my two best friends what I had done, one was speechless and really didn’t know what to say but ‘ok’ and the other reminded me that massage therapy was very physical work. My only response was that I knew that already and was up for the challenge! So not quite the reactions I was looking for but when I make an impulsive decision and set my mind to it; there’s really nothing anyone can say to change my mind-laughing out loud 

School began on September 30, 2013 and within a couple of days I knew I had made the right decision. I was meeting new people and learned very quickly massage therapy was more than just an hour’s worth of relaxation at a spa. I was actually placing myself in a position where I can truly help people one day. As the school year was progressing my best friends could see how much I loved it and how important school became to me and ended up being my biggest cheerleaders. I was getting a much needed breather from the corporate world and bonding with people that I will be friends with for life. I was literally starting a whole new career path that I never thought was possible and it was going to give me the much needed time and financial ability to write and publish my first book.

I graduated on June 21st of this year and after spending a couple of months focusing on studying for my state required exam, October 30th my license to practice massage therapy became effective. Thirteen months to the day I began this new journey I am now able to call myself a Licensed Massage Therapist! I’m one of those people that need to accomplish one goal at a time. I’ve hurdled a very huge step in the process to becoming a full-time writer. Now it may be a year or two before I accomplish this next goal or it may be twenty or thirty years from now. But the main thing is I am one step closer to reaching that goal and no one can ever take that from me!

For those of you that are looking for career or life changes; you should create a plan of action for yourself. It doesn’t have to be as drastic as surviving a company layoff as I had to do, but it can be smaller actions that need to be taken to reach those goals. And don’t forget to ask God for help and be ready for whatever it is he sends your way. I asked God for financial freedom for at least six months so I can jump start a writing career. He provided that; it just wasn’t what I had imagined it would be. In fact it was so much more than what I thought it could be which only leads me to believe my ambitions to be a writer will not only become true but also be very rewarding as well.

So remember never give up and let nothing hold you back!
